Output 349536b631fba408227256aaf4af3b141480c79745ef206453d4b5611774359a:1

value
3326940
script pubkey
OP_0 OP_PUSHBYTES_20 010eb649701e0e6b24a09e9c13c7d6c5bc92423c
address
bc1qqy8tvjtsrc8xkf9qn6wp837kck7fys3uyn4xrd
transaction
349536b631fba408227256aaf4af3b141480c79745ef206453d4b5611774359a
spent
true